On 22 November 2023, Chancellor Jeremy Hunt delivered his Autumn Statement, potentially the last such statement to precede the next UK general election.Despite mounting speculation over the past few days, there were no rabbits in the Chancellor’s hat, and today’s announcements were broadly in keeping with expectations. The headline items included the announcement that the current full expensing policy for businesses will be made permanent – a move which the Chancellor heralded as “the biggest business tax cut in modern British history” – and various changes to National Insurance contributions (NICs), including a reduction of the main rate and the abolition of Class 2 NICs for self-employed individuals. ...
